Led by the China Geological Survey, the project represents a major milestone in China-Saudi geoscience cooperation and provides new geological data for mineral exploration and mining investment in Saudi Arabia.<\/p>\n<p>The 1:100,000-scale geological mapping project covers approximately 600,000 square kilometers of the Saudi Arabian Shield. Described as the world\u2019s largest geological mapping technical service project of the 21st century, it is a key cooperation program under the Belt and Road Initiative and Saudi Arabia\u2019s Vision 2030. The project is designed to clarify the region\u2019s tectonic framework, geological evolution and mineralization patterns through systematic, high-resolution mapping.<\/p>\n<p>The 24 maps released in the first batch cover a combined area of 70,800 square kilometers and include major gold, copper, zinc, chromium and rare-metal mineralization belts across the Arabian Shield. They represent Saudi Arabia\u2019s first systematic, large-scale and high-precision geological mapping products for the region.<\/p>\n<p><img loading=\"lazy\" decoding=\"async\" class=\"alignnone wp-image-89639 size-full\" src=\"\/wp-content\/uploads\/2026\/09\/Area-Covered-by-the-First-Batch-of-Geological-Mapping-Results-scaled.webp\" alt=\"Area Covered by the First Batch of Geological Mapping Results\" width=\"2560\" height=\"1491\" srcset=\"\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2026\/09\/Area-Covered-by-the-First-Batch-of-Geological-Mapping-Results-scaled.webp 2560w, \/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2026\/09\/Area-Covered-by-the-First-Batch-of-Geological-Mapping-Results-300x175.webp 300w, \/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2026\/09\/Area-Covered-by-the-First-Batch-of-Geological-Mapping-Results-1024x596.webp 1024w, \/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2026\/09\/Area-Covered-by-the-First-Batch-of-Geological-Mapping-Results-768x447.webp 768w, \/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2026\/09\/Area-Covered-by-the-First-Batch-of-Geological-Mapping-Results-1536x895.webp 1536w, \/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2026\/09\/Area-Covered-by-the-First-Batch-of-Geological-Mapping-Results-2048x1193.webp 2048w\" sizes=\"(max-width: 2560px) 100vw, 2560px\" \/><\/p>\n<p><em>Area Covered by the First Batch of Geological Mapping Results<\/em><\/p>\n<p>Each map is supported by an integrated package comprising a professional geological map, a technical report and a spatial database. Together, the products update regional information on geological structures and mineral distribution while addressing a longstanding gap in detailed geological data.<\/p>\n<p><img loading=\"lazy\" decoding=\"async\" class=\"alignnone wp-image-89644 size-full\" src=\"\/wp-content\/uploads\/2026\/09\/The-24-Geological-Mapping-Sheets-Released-in-the-First-Batch-scaled.webp\" alt=\"The 24 Geological Mapping Sheets Released in the First Batch\" width=\"2560\" height=\"1436\" srcset=\"\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2026\/09\/The-24-Geological-Mapping-Sheets-Released-in-the-First-Batch-scaled.webp 2560w, \/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2026\/09\/The-24-Geological-Mapping-Sheets-Released-in-the-First-Batch-300x168.webp 300w, \/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2026\/09\/The-24-Geological-Mapping-Sheets-Released-in-the-First-Batch-1024x575.webp 1024w, \/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2026\/09\/The-24-Geological-Mapping-Sheets-Released-in-the-First-Batch-768x431.webp 768w, \/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2026\/09\/The-24-Geological-Mapping-Sheets-Released-in-the-First-Batch-1536x862.webp 1536w, \/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2026\/09\/The-24-Geological-Mapping-Sheets-Released-in-the-First-Batch-2048x1149.webp 2048w\" sizes=\"(max-width: 2560px) 100vw, 2560px\" \/><\/p>\n<p><em>The 24 Geological Mapping Sheets Released in the First Batch<\/em><\/p>\n<p>During the mapping work, the project identified new mineralization anomalies and exploration clues, and delineated a series of prospective areas for further investigation. The resulting data have been integrated into Saudi Arabia\u2019s national geoscience database portal, where they are available to government agencies, research institutions and mining companies. The information can support mineral exploration, land-use planning and geological hazard prevention.<\/p>\n<h2>Digital Mapping and Multisource Interpretation<\/h2>\n<p>The project used a digital and intelligent geological mapping workflow based on GoField, a field geological data acquisition system developed by the Chinese project team. Remote sensing, geophysical and geochemical data were combined for integrated geological interpretation.<\/p>\n<p>A multilevel quality-control system was established across the full production chain, including preliminary geological map compilation, field mapping, sample testing, final map preparation and report writing. All deliverables were monitored throughout the process by an international third-party supervision organization and underwent phased acceptance inspections.<\/p>\n<p>The Saudi Geological Survey said the high-precision mapping results have significantly strengthened the country\u2019s basic geological capabilities and provide critical data support for the transformation and development of its mining industry.<\/p>\n<p>The project was led by the Xi\u2019an Center of the China Geological Survey, with participation from the Institute of Geology of the Chinese Academy of Geological Sciences and several other affiliated institutions, including the Nanjing, Shenyang and Wuhan centers of the China Geological Survey. Geological exploration organizations from Shandong, Guangxi, Gansu and Jiangsu, as well as Chang\u2019an University and Northwest University, also contributed to the work.<\/p>\n<p>Chinese and Saudi teams conducted joint field operations, practical training and technical workshops. Saudi geological technicians, particularly younger professionals, participated in the project\u2019s full workflow, supporting technology transfer, knowledge sharing and the development of Saudi Arabia\u2019s domestic geoscience workforce.<\/p>\n<p>The early release of foundational geological data is also expected to improve the information available to international and domestic mining companies assessing exploration and development opportunities in Saudi Arabia.<\/p>\n<p>China and Saudi Arabia plan to continue mapping additional areas of the Arabian Shield while expanding cooperation in geoscience data sharing, technical exchanges and mining-related industrial activities.
